E LAKE SHORE DR in Sangamon, Illinois is rated Fair in the FHWA's 2024 National Bridge Inventory.

Built in 1969, it carries 3 rated components on the inspecting agency's 0-9 scale, and its weakest reported component scores 6. The lowest applicable rating sets the federal condition category, so this Fair result describes the weakest reported component rather than the structure as a whole. No NBI category is a closure decision or a live crossing-safety verdict.

Bridge Snapshot: E LAKE SHORE DR

The E LAKE SHORE DR bridge in Sangamon, Illinois carries E LAKE SHORE DR over I-55. It was built in 1969, making it 57 years old today. It was last reconstructed in 2003, extending its service life. The structure is built primarily of steel continuous and spans 2 sections, stretching 79.9 meters (262 feet) end to end. Daily traffic averages 3,750 vehicles, placing it in the moderately-trafficked tier of Illinois bridges. It is owned and maintained by State Highway Agency.

The latest FHWA inspection records show a deck rating of 7/9, superstructure at 7/9, substructure at 6/9. The weakest component sits in fair condition. No reported major component scores in the Poor range under the current federal condition thresholds.

Age against the county: built in 1969, earlier than 333 of Sangamon's 466 bridges with a recorded construction year (71%), against a county median build year of 1980. Age is not a defect on its own, but it is the population from which future Poor ratings are drawn.

Condition Analysis

  • The deck (driving surface) is in good condition (7/9), showing no significant deterioration.
  • The superstructure (beams and supports above the deck) rates good at 7/9, with no significant deterioration on file.
  • The substructure (piers and abutments) is in fair condition (6/9), with minor deterioration that may require routine maintenance.
